MY APPROACHES

I have been practicing for 22 years in various sectors and with various audiences. My practice is therefore heterogeneous and adaptable. However, it is governed by the strict principles of therapy, although I offer different forms of intervention.

For individuals:
  •     Individual consultation: it is a space in which I help the client to talk about their anxiety and thereby, to unfold the problem that leads them to consult. It is an introspective time during which they can be brought to revisit their story and the feelings that are linked to it. For the patient, it is indeed a question of clarifying the origin of their disorders but also of deciphering the difficulties they are currently encountering in their relationship to the world and to others around them.
Depending on the depth and duration of the problems encountered, the duration of psychological work or "therapy" may vary according to each individual.
  •     The "couple therapy": we are interested here in the intimate bond that unites two people. When the couple is damaged, it is common to look for a culprit and to throw two in the painful pursuit of blaming the other. I am offering here the possibility of a structured space to unfold personal issues and understand the subjective responsibilities in this dynamic. This is the opportunity to get to know your partner from a different perspective and to re-engage in dialogue in a different way.
  •     "Family" work or rather said consultation "for a child": by virtue of its particular status, the child has access to the therapy space only through the consultation request made by the parent.
It is in this particular context that I welcome, during a first meeting, the child and their parents to come and talk to me about what brings them to consult.
This time makes it possible to confirm the possibility of psychological work for the child but also to promote parent / child communication. The psychological follow-up of the child takes the form of individual sessions. It is through the support of games and other playful means of expression - drawing, modeling - that I offer children the possibility of expressing their difficulties.

And professionals:
  •     Supervision: it is an individual consultation. It is primarily intended for psychologists and other healthcare professionals and for people who wish to talk about sensitive, intimate points of their practices and possibly directions to take in their relationship with their own patients.
  •     "Control": session of regulation of practice and transference addressed to psychoanalysts.
  •     Analysis of practices or "team supervision": work regulation; it is aimed at any team that wants a space of hindsight to discuss problematic situations together in the context of the intervention with patients. These are team meetings during which I make it easier for caregivers to talk about  suffering linked to the meeting with the patient and / or helps to resolve collective resistance to the advancement of patient care.
